Transaction 18cc60cf261762ec6fbb286a6f9e90f3820ad4f3cefd644dc103f396decd78c7
1 Input
1 Output
-
18cc60cf261762ec6fbb286a6f9e90f3820ad4f3cefd644dc103f396decd78c7:0
- value
- 4487288
- script pubkey
- OP_0 OP_PUSHBYTES_20 20c07f5b6a7c2fbc2664a434a3911b97c955b812
- address
- bc1qyrq87km20shmcfny5s628ygmjly4twqj7dm4gq